Default Oil grades Question... 1993 Honda Del Sol recommends 5W 30 is it ok to use 5W 20?

Oil grades Question... I have a 1993 Del Sol it uses 5W 30 and our other two 2001 Hondas use 5W 20. Is it ok to run 5W 20 in the Del Sol. I think it should be alright but want to be sure before doing so.

i wouldnt use 5w-20 theres really no point it is a thinner oil and is basically coming out for the new fords and newer honda's. if you want a better oil then 5w-30 you can get synthetic 5w-30 or 10w-30 summer is almost over so you can just stick to 5w-30 theres no point to switch to 5w-20. Any reason why you want to switch?

it wont hurt your car if you switch if thats what your aiming at.

I run 10/30 or 10/40. I will never run 5/3j0 or 5/20 because it is too thin for my liking. The only reason I would run that thin of oil would be if I drove the car in 30degf or less. A thicker oil will stay in the bearings better thus reducing friction. If you want an oil chart, get a haynes manual and look in the first few pages. They have what grade of oil is best for what temperatures. I know its different with difefrent auto makers because I had a dodge ram 50 and then a civic manual and the scales were different. Also if you had hydrualic lifters(which you don't) then I would be worried about running too thick of an oil, but unless you go pass a straight 30 weight, you shouldn't have a problem.
